Lewis Richardson was a fictional character on the long-running Channel 4 British television soap opera Hollyoaks.

He was played by actor Ben Hull between 1997-2001.

[edit] Character History

Lewis first arrived in Hollyoaks as part of the Richardson family, and was protected over his sister Mandy after the pair used to received abuse from their father Dennis. Lewis moved in to a flat above the Video Shop with friends Jude and Dawn Cunningham. Lewis than briefly started to date Jude but it ended it with her after discovering from Benny about Jude’s criminal activities. Shocking news came for Lewis when he discovered that his sister Mandy has gone missing and Lewis and his father begin to search for her. Lewis began to panic with the possibility that Mandy had committed suicide, but fortunately, Lewis found Mandy alive in a hospital, and rushed to her bedside. Lewis was devastated when Mandy confessed that their father Dennis had raped her. Lewis supported Mandy, as the pair reported the incident to the police and their father Dennis was arrested. Lewis took care of Mandy and helped her through her trial, as their father was found guilty and was sentence for seven years.

Lewis than began to have an affair with Ruth Osborne, but they kept it a secret, but it lasted a while when Ruth confessed that she slept with Luke Morgan and Lewis dumped her. Beth Morgan arrived in Hollyoaks, and Lewis immediately got together with her, but realised Beth was too young for him and he split up with her. Lewis was shocked to discover a pregnancy test kit and assumed it was Mandy's, but it turned out to be his mother Helen's, as she revealed she was pregnant with Gordon Cunninghams child. With Lewis's mother getting married to Gordon, soon Lewis realised that he still had feelings for Ruth and the pair got back together. Lewis was than hailed a hero after rescuing Lucy Benson, with Tony Hutchinson and Ruth from Rob Hawthorne. Lewis than went into business with best friend Rory "Finn" Finnigan, as the pair opened up night-club The Loft. He then started to get friendly with a local club owner Lorraine Wilson, and Lewis started to gamble in her casino. Lewis's life was turned upside down, when he heard that Ruth had an abortion of his baby, and he ended up hitting her. Lewis started to borrow money of Lorraine, soon he ended up in debt and Lorraine offered Lewis the chance of wiping out his debt, if he sleeps with her. Ruth than discovered Lewis's debts and his stealing, and ended up hitting him and in a rage he hit her back. Lewis and Ruth broke up, and Helen began to get suspicious of Lewis's gambling problems which continued to spiral and, in a moment of madness, he almost hit his own mother. Lewis decided to clear his head out and went to Ireland and returned as a new man with flash clothes. However, a loan shark came after Lewis, because he took a loan out in Ireland using the name of Ruth dead husband Kurt Benson. Lewis was told that the loan must be repaid within thirty days. In order to pay off his debt, Lewis slept with Geri Hudson, and stole the money that she made from a charity event. Soon, Ruth discovered Lewis's debts and persuaded Tony to buy Lewis out of The Loft, thus severing all links with him.

In the late night series Hollyoaks: Movin' On, Lewis tried to persuade Ruth to get back with him, but Ruth got angry when she discovered that Lewis used Kurt’s name for his debts. Lewis than went to Ruth’s flat and tryed to force himself on her, and Ruth told him that he was just like his father, which encouraged Lewis to beat her up bad. Lewis felt guilty for what he had done so he took an overdose of pill and later died in hospital. With early influences of his father violence towards his family, Lewis never wanted to be anything like his father, but towards the end he realised that he just like him and couldn't do anything about it. Lewis left a devastated mother behind and sister who found it hard to understand how the person who had protected her against their father could ever hurt another woman.
